What is permaculture?
Permacutlure. Working with nature.
Permaculture is a term created in the 1970s.
Permaculturists work with nature rather than against it to
design environments with as small an impact on the earth as possible.
It is widely based on traditional forms of agriculture
from around the world
– ancient knowledge of the Maya, the Incas, Aborigines of Australia –
brought into everyday practice.
It is a system of design which can be used in gardens,
farms, workplaces, homes, and courtyards – just about anywhere where people live.
And it does not have to be about growing plants. It can be about organising your lifestyle or your workplace.
It is based on a simple set of ethics and design principles
that can be adapted to many purposes.
